What is a Pragmatic Slot?

A pragmatic slot is a placeholder in a sentence or dialogue that is designed to record particular pieces of details that are pertinent to the context or the purpose of the communication. These slots are not just syntactic or semantic placeholders but are deeply rooted in the pragmatic aspects of language, which handle the context and the intended significance behind words and sentences.

For instance, in the sentence "I want to book a flight from New York to Los Angeles," the pragmatic slots may consist of:

  • Source Location: New York
  • Destination Location: Los Angeles
  • Date of Travel: (if defined in the discussion)
  • Class of Travel: (if defined in the discussion)

Each of these slots records a piece of information that is crucial for the task of booking a flight. The concept of pragmatic slots is particularly beneficial in discussion systems, where the objective is to extract and use specific details from user inputs to perform actions or supply relevant reactions.

Applications of Pragmatic Slots

Pragmatic slots are commonly utilized in various applications, including:

  1. Virtual Assistants: Smart assistants like Siri, Alexa, and Google Assistant use pragmatic slots to comprehend user requests and offer relevant actions. For example, when a user asks, "What's the weather condition like in London tomorrow?" the system identifies the slots for location (London) and date (tomorrow) to bring the suitable weather condition information.

How Pragmatic Slots Work

The process of using pragmatic slots includes several actions:

  1. Slot Definition: Defining the slots that are relevant to the job or application. For a flight reservation system, this might include source area, destination area, travel date, and travel class.
  2. Slot Filling: Filling the slots with the suitable details extracted from user inputs. This can be done utilizing different NLP techniques such as named entity recognition (NER) and dependency parsing.
  3. Context Management: Ensuring that the system keeps the context of the conversation and can fill out missing slots based upon previous interactions. For example, if the user has currently discussed the travel date, the system must remember this details for subsequent actions.
  4. Action Execution: Once all required slots are filled, the system can perform the intended action, such as reserving a flight or bring weather condition information.

Challenges in Implementing Pragmatic Slots

While the concept of pragmatic slots is effective, implementing them effectively can be difficult. Some common problems include:

  • Ambiguity: User inputs can be ambiguous, making it difficult to fill slots properly. For instance, "I desire to go to the airport" might indicate various things depending on the context.
  • Incomplete Information: Users might not offer all the essential details in one go, needing the system to ask follow-up questions.
  • Natural Language Variations: Users can express the exact same info in various methods, which can complicate slot filling. For instance, "Departure time" could be revealed as "When do I leave?" or "What's the flight time?"
